~4th Grade Economics Project~ 4th Grade Mall of Entrepreneurs

Project Summary Students will be broken up into groups of 2 or 3 as determined by Miss Kelley. Each group will create a business where they will sell either a good or service to the school during the 4th Grade Mall on Wednesday January 31st. Important Dates: Bring a blank poster to school on Tuesday, December 19th (any color) Business Plan due on Thursday, December 21st (distributed and completed at school) 4th Grade Mall: Wednesday, January 31st Economics-Related Goals: In this project students will…

… understand the difference between goods and services. … use knowledge of supply and demand to think of a product with high demand … learn how pricing affects sales … learn the affect that advertising has on sales …. find total profit by subtracting expenses from sales … demonstrate understanding of economic vocabulary.

Student Goals: During the entire duration of this project students will…

… learn to cooperate with other students in their group … practice compromising with others to come up with an idea all group members agree with … each have an important role in the planning and execution of their businesses.

Project Components Step 1: Complete Business Plan with group members. (At school). Step 2: Create a poster-board advertisement for business. (At school) Step 3: Advertise business in 4th Grade Mall infomercial to be shown at chapel. (At school) Step 4: Create store-front display (At school) Step 5: Prepare goods or services to sell (At home) Step 6: Sell goods and services during 4th Grade Mall on February 2nd. (during school) Step 7: Complete “Accounting Sheet” detailing all expenses and sales to determine final profit. (at school) Restrictions:

•   Students may not sell baked goods. •   Goods that students sell must be made by 4th grade group members. Students

may not re-sell purchased items. (Examples could be student-made bracelets, headbands, crafts, decorated fun pencils, duct tape art, pencil holders, etc)

•   Services sold must be given by 4th graders (Examples could be nail-painting, application of temporary tattoos, desk/locker cleaning, etc)
